2.6 DMA
Currently, there are two DMA architectures used on 'C6x devices: DMA and
EDMA (enhanced DMA). Devices such as the '6201 have the DMA peripheral,
whereas the '6211 has the EDMA peripheral. The two architectures are differ-
ent enough to warrant a separate API module for each. The DMA module in-
cludes:
Constants
J
DMA_CHA_CNT
J
DMA_SUPPORT
Functions
J
DMA_AllocGlobalReg
J
DMA_AutoStart
J
DMA_Close
J
DMA_ConfigA
J
DMA_ConfigB
J
DMA_FreeGlobalReg
J
DMA_GetEventId
J
DMA_GetGlobalReg
J
DMA_GetStatus
J
DMA_Open
J
DMA_Pause
J
DMA_Reset
J
DMA_SetAuxCtl
J
DMA_SetGlobalReg
J
DMA_Start
J
DMA_Stop
J
DMA_Wait
Macros
J
DMA_CLEAR_CONDITION
J
DMA_GET_CONDITION
Macros (cont.)
CSL API Module Descriptions
DMA
2-11
Need help?
Do you have a question about the TMS320C6000 and is the answer not in the manual?
Questions and answers